They were begun in 1934 when Frederic M. Hanes, an avid gardener and iris lover as well as important figure in Duke's medical center, persuaded Benjamin N. Duke's widow, Sarah P. Duke, to pay $20,000 for a garden featuring irises. While Shipmans planting scheme proved an incomplete success on the terraces where most of the perennials failed to flourish, many of her Japanese cherries, crabapples, and shrub plantings have survived, adding color and texture to the garden. This browser does not support getting your location. In 1937 a donation from Mary Duke Biddle (in memory of her mother, benefactor Sarah P. Duke) helped transform the site into a 55-acre designed landscape containing a nearly twelve-acre Terrace Garden by landscape architect Ellen Shipman.
